Web15 Aug 2024 · For construction of seventh order WENO schemes, we use Legendre polynomials to span the solution with respect to space variables. Using Legendre polynomial as a basis function allows us to write smoothness indicators in a compact form [4] , hence facilitating the design of a computationally efficient scheme.
